    POSCO is a global steelmaker with over 60,000 employees,162 subsidiaries in over 50 countries. POSCO – MKPC Sdn. Bhd., a joint – venture company between Prestar Resources Berhad and POSCO.     What’s it like working at Posco?

    AI summary of recent reviews

    Employees appreciate the wide range of benefits at Posco, including quarterly incentives and performance-based bonuses. The working environment is generally friendly and well-organised, with helpful colleagues and accessible management. Staff value the excellent facilities, such as the company canteen providing free meals and wonderful team building programmes. Training opportunities are worthwhile, including overseas training to Korea and other Posco locations. Many employees also note the good work/life balance with a five-day working week.

    However, there are some potential challenges, such as a heavy workload with adhoc tasks and short lead times requiring high focus. Employees note the need to meet high standards and company targets, with fast responses required by management. Some staff have mentioned that salary levels may be lower than expected given the workload, with average remuneration and modest pay rises. Additionally, a few employees have experienced inconsistent management support, with some departments being less receptive to staff feedback.
